Mammalian Metallothionein (MTs) are a sort of low-molecular-weight, thiol-rich and metal-binding proteins, which mainly function as detoxifying agents and in essential metals metabolism. Mouse MT-1 has different domains, a and B, which not only have independent structures and functions but also differ in metal-binding favors, a-KKS-a (aa), was obtained in our lab and it shows in vitro a stronger ability than the natural MT to bind some heavy metals such as Cd. Based on this knowledge, we overexpressed MT and aa protein in Alternanthera philoxeroides and hoped to study the function of aa in vitro. Another aim of this work was to improve the tolerance and accumulation to heavy metals of plants for phytoremediation.1.Study on tissue culture of Alternanthera PhiloxeroidesThis study examined the effects of explants, media and exogenous phytohormone on tissue culture of Alternanthera philoxeroides. The stems, leaves and roots were used as the explants to study tissue cultue. Different basic media [MS, 1/2 MS, MS (1/2), B5], 0 ~ 0.5 mg/L of indoleacetic acid (IAA), 0 ~ 0.2 mg/L of naphthyl acetic acid (NAA), 0.5 ~ 5.0 mg/L of 6-benzylaminopurine (6-BA) and 0.5 ~ 4.0 mg/L of Zeatin (ZT) as additional compositions were used for inducing, differentiating and rooting tests. Induced results showed that 1/2 MS was more suitable for calli to grow and divide than B5, MS (1/2) and MS. The stem and leaf of Alternanthera philoxeroides were suitable organs for tissue culture. Stem > leaf was observed on growth rate. The combinations of NAA and BA or IAA and ZT can induce calli of the stem and leaf of Alternanthera philoxeroides, and the rate of calli induction increases with the increase of BA concentration. The higher rate of NAA/BA, the more roots from the calli format.2. Establishment of genetic transformation system for Alternanthera PhiloxeroidesIn this study the potential of a transformation system for Alternanthera philoxeroides via meristems cocultivated with Agrobacterium was evaluated. The Phosphinothricin (PPT) and Cadmium(Cd) with different mass concentrations were respectively added into the meida, the effects of PPT and Cd on the growth of explants were observed so as to determine its minimum lethal mass concentration, which was to be used for studying genetic transformation of Alternanthera philoxeroides. The experimental results showed that the minimum lethal mass concentration of PPT for the differention of Alternanthera philoxeroides was 4.0 mg/L and Cd was 150 umol/L. The study of the amenability of Agrobacterium-mediated gene transferred to Alternanthera philoxeroides indicated that the shoot regeneration ratio from excised Agrobacterium inoculated Alternanthera philoxeroides meristems for 10 ~ 15 min got to 70 %. So it was thought that this study could provide the prerequisite for genetic transformation of Alternanthera philoxeroides.3. Expression of MT and aa genes in transgenic Alternanthera PhiloxeroidesThe plant expression vector pGPTVd35S-MT/aa gene was indemnified and introduced into Agrobacterium tumefaciens strain EHA105. A method of regenerating from the meristem was developed for Agrobacterium-mediated transformation. In this procedure, the cells of the meristem were targeted for transformation. In this present study, the shoot developed successfully on media which did not contain plant hormone, transformants of meristems were selected on 1/2 MS medium with 4.0 mg/L PPT or 150 umol/L Cd2+. However, the transformation frequency of meristem tissue proved to be extremely low. From all transformation experiments, in which a total of 1364 meristems were excised, two transformed shoots were obtained. The presence of the aimed genes in transformants genome was detected by PCR. Dot blot analysis revealed that MT and aa protein had expressed in Alternanthera Philoxeroides. Transformants displayed higher resistance to Cd than control plants.
